Air India cancels more flights as conflict in Middle East disrupts routes
Air India has announced the cancellation of several flights due to the escalating conflict between Iran and the United States, which has significantly disrupted air routes in the region. The tensions, marked by military confrontations and political instability, have raised safety concerns for airlines operating in and around affected areas. As a precautionary measure, Air India has decided to suspend its services to ensure passenger safety and compliance with international travel advisories. This disruption follows a broader trend affecting various airlines as the geopolitical situation continues to evolve. The cancellations are expected to impact travelers significantly, prompting Air India to offer alternative arrangements wherever possible. Passengers are advised to stay informed about their flight status and check with the airline for updates. The ongoing crisis not only affects air travel but also has implications for trade and economic relations in the region, highlighting the interconnected nature of global events and their local repercussions.
